Med-Or Italian Foundation organizes the webinar “International Mediterranean Forum”

Med-Or Italian Foundation organized the webinar titled “International Mediterranean Forum” in collaboration with Istanbul University’s Faculty of Political Science.

On May 13, 2026, the Med-Or Italian Foundation, in collaboration with the Faculty of Political Science of Istanbul University, organized the webinar titled “International Mediterranean Forum.”

The initiative brought together professors and academics from Italy and Turkey to discuss the main dynamics shaping the Mediterranean region, as well as the prospects for cooperation between the two countries in an area that is becoming increasingly central to the international geopolitical landscape.

Following the opening remarks by Massimo Khairallah, Director of International Relations at Med-Or, Adam Esen, Dean of the Faculty of Political Science of the Istanbul University, and Çağatay Özdemir, Professor at Istanbul University and member of Med-Or’s International Board, presentations were delivered by Aylin Ece Çiçek (Istanbul University), Riccardo Redaelli (Catholic University of Milan), Muhittin Ataman (Ankara University), Niccolò Petrelli (Roma Tre University), Alessia Melcangi (Sapienza University of Rome), Raffaele Marchetti (LUISS Guido Carli University), Giray Gerim (Istanbul University), and Kıvanç Ulusoy (Istanbul University).

The forum offered an important opportunity for dialogue between Italian and Turkish perspectives on the ongoing transformations in the Mediterranean. It also reaffirmed Med-Or’s commitment to promoting academic exchange, dialogue, and cooperation among scholars and international experts.
